I bought this phone on second day of launch and believe me, this is the best phone ive used. Performance is smooth with stock android. 21 Mp camera does really amazing job.
Go for It.
PROS-
1) 21Mp Camera campures very descent images with good detail
2) Stock Android experience,
3) Very good Battery Life, lasts upto 1 and half day of medium usage
4) Premium Look
5) Trust of Motorola
CONS-
1) Heating issue with Heavy Gaming